package com.widget.view;import java.util.ArrayList;import java.util.List;import android.annotation.SuppressLint;import android.content.Context;import android.content.res.TypedArray;import android.os.Build;import android.util.AttributeSet;import android.view.View;import android.view.ViewGroup;import android.view.accessibility.AccessibilityEvent;import android.view.accessibility.AccessibilityNodeInfo;import android.widget.CompoundButton;import android.widget.LinearLayout;import android.widget.RadioButton;/** * 复杂样式的单选框,自定义RadioGroup实现RadioButton多行多列排列布局 * * 1、使用与RadioGroup一样,MutilRadioGroup里的所有RadioButton(包括MutilRadioGroup里嵌套的子布局里面的所有RadioButton)属于同一组。2、增加方法setCheckWithoutNotification(int id),设置默认的RadioButton被选中,但是不响应监听事件。 * @author https://github.com/pheng/android_radiogroup_MutilRadioGroup * */public class MutilRadioGroup extends LinearLayout { // holds the checked id; the selection is empty by default private int mCheckedId = -1; // tracks children radio buttons checked state private CompoundButton.OnCheckedChangeListener mChildOnCheckedChangeListener; // when true, mOnCheckedChangeListener discards events private boolean mProtectFromCheckedChange = false; private OnCheckedChangeListener mOnCheckedChangeListener; private PassThroughHierarchyChangeListener mPassThroughListener; /** * {@inheritDoc} */ public MutilRadioGroup(Context context) { super(context); setOrientation(VERTICAL); init(); } /** * {@inheritDoc} */ public MutilRadioGroup(Context context, AttributeSet attrs) { super(context, attrs); init(); } private void init() { mChildOnCheckedChangeListener = new CheckedStateTracker(); mPassThroughListener = new PassThroughHierarchyChangeListener(); super.setOnHierarchyChangeListener(mPassThroughListener); } /** * {@inheritDoc} */ @Override public void setOnHierarchyChangeListener(OnHierarchyChangeListener listener) { // the user listener is delegated to our pass-through listener mPassThroughListener.mOnHierarchyChangeListener = listener; } /** * set the default checked radio button, without notification the listeners * @param mCheckedId the default checked radio button's id, if none use -1 */ public void setCheckWithoutNotification(int id){ if (id != -1 && (id == mCheckedId)) { return; } mProtectFromCheckedChange = true; if (mCheckedId != -1) { setCheckedStateForView(mCheckedId, false); } if (id != -1) { mProtectFromCheckedChange = true; } mProtectFromCheckedChange = false; mCheckedId = id; } @Override public void addView(View child, int index, ViewGroup.LayoutParams params) { List<RadioButton> btns = getAllRadioButton(child); if(btns != null && btns.size() > 0){ for(RadioButton button : btns){ if (button.isChecked()) { mProtectFromCheckedChange = true; if (mCheckedId != -1) { setCheckedStateForView(mCheckedId, false); } mProtectFromCheckedChange = false; setCheckedId(button.getId()); } } } super.addView(child, index, params); } /** * get all radio buttons which are in the view * @param child */ private List<RadioButton> getAllRadioButton(View child){ List<RadioButton> btns = new ArrayList<RadioButton>(); if (child instanceof RadioButton) { btns.add((RadioButton) child); }else if(child instanceof ViewGroup){ int counts = ((ViewGroup) child).getChildCount(); for(int i = 0; i < counts; i++){ btns.addAll(getAllRadioButton(((ViewGroup) child).getChildAt(i))); } } return btns; } /** * <p>Sets the selection to the radio button whose identifier is passed in * parameter. Using -1 as the selection identifier clears the selection; * such an operation is equivalent to invoking {@link #clearCheck()}.</p> * * @param id the unique id of the radio button to select in this group * * @see #getCheckedRadioButtonId() * @see #clearCheck() */ public void check(int id) { // don't even bother if (id != -1 && (id == mCheckedId)) { return; } if (mCheckedId != -1) { setCheckedStateForView(mCheckedId, false); } if (id != -1) { setCheckedStateForView(id, true); } setCheckedId(id); } private void setCheckedId(int id) { mCheckedId = id; if (mOnCheckedChangeListener != null) { mOnCheckedChangeListener.onCheckedChanged(this, mCheckedId); } } private void setCheckedStateForView(int viewId, boolean checked) { View checkedView = findViewById(viewId); if (checkedView != null && checkedView instanceof RadioButton) { ((RadioButton) checkedView).setChecked(checked); } } /** * <p>Returns the identifier of the selected radio button in this group. * Upon empty selection, the returned value is -1.</p> * * @return the unique id of the selected radio button in this group * * @see #check(int) * @see #clearCheck() * * @attr ref android.R.styleable#MyRadioGroup_checkedButton */ public int getCheckedRadioButtonId() { return mCheckedId; } /** * <p>Clears the selection. When the selection is cleared, no radio button * in this group is selected and {@link #getCheckedRadioButtonId()} returns * null.</p> * * @see #check(int) * @see #getCheckedRadioButtonId() */ public void clearCheck() { check(-1); } /** * <p>Register a callback to be invoked when the checked radio button * changes in this group.</p> * * @param listener the callback to call on checked state change */ public void setOnCheckedChangeListener(OnCheckedChangeListener listener) { mOnCheckedChangeListener = listener; } /** * {@inheritDoc} */ @Override public LayoutParams generateLayoutParams(AttributeSet attrs) { return new MutilRadioGroup.LayoutParams(getContext(), attrs); } /** * {@inheritDoc} */ @Override protected boolean checkLayoutParams(ViewGroup.LayoutParams p) { return p instanceof MutilRadioGroup.LayoutParams; } @Override protected LinearLayout.LayoutParams generateDefaultLayoutParams() { return new LayoutParams(LayoutParams.WRAP_CONTENT, LayoutParams.WRAP_CONTENT); } @Override public void onInitializeAccessibilityEvent(AccessibilityEvent event) { super.onInitializeAccessibilityEvent(event); event.setClassName(MutilRadioGroup.class.getName()); } @Override public void onInitializeAccessibilityNodeInfo(AccessibilityNodeInfo info) { super.onInitializeAccessibilityNodeInfo(info); info.setClassName(MutilRadioGroup.class.getName()); } /** * <p>This set of layout parameters defaults the width and the height of * the children to {@link #WRAP_CONTENT} when they are not specified in the * XML file. Otherwise, this class ussed the value read from the XML file.</p> * * <p>See * {@link android.R.styleable#LinearLayout_Layout LinearLayout Attributes} * for a list of all child view attributes that this class supports.</p> * */ public static class LayoutParams extends LinearLayout.LayoutParams { /** * {@inheritDoc} */ public LayoutParams(Context c, AttributeSet attrs) { super(c, attrs); } /** * {@inheritDoc} */ public LayoutParams(int w, int h) { super(w, h); } /** * {@inheritDoc} */ public LayoutParams(int w, int h, float initWeight) { super(w, h, initWeight); } /** * {@inheritDoc} */ public LayoutParams(ViewGroup.LayoutParams p) { super(p); } /** * {@inheritDoc} */ public LayoutParams(MarginLayoutParams source) { super(source); } /** * <p>Fixes the child's width to * {@link android.view.ViewGroup.LayoutParams#WRAP_CONTENT} and the child's * height to {@link android.view.ViewGroup.LayoutParams#WRAP_CONTENT} * when not specified in the XML file.</p> * * @param a the styled attributes set * @param widthAttr the width attribute to fetch * @param heightAttr the height attribute to fetch */ @Override protected void setBaseAttributes(TypedArray a, int widthAttr, int heightAttr) { if (a.hasValue(widthAttr)) { width = a.getLayoutDimension(widthAttr, "layout_width"); } else { width = WRAP_CONTENT; } if (a.hasValue(heightAttr)) { height = a.getLayoutDimension(heightAttr, "layout_height"); } else { height = WRAP_CONTENT; } } } /** * <p>Interface definition for a callback to be invoked when the checked * radio button changed in this group.</p> */ public interface OnCheckedChangeListener { /** * <p>Called when the checked radio button has changed. When the * selection is cleared, checkedId is -1.</p> * * @param group the group in which the checked radio button has changed * @param checkedId the unique identifier of the newly checked radio button */ public void onCheckedChanged(MutilRadioGroup group, int checkedId); } private class CheckedStateTracker implements CompoundButton.OnCheckedChangeListener { public void onCheckedChanged(CompoundButton buttonView, boolean isChecked) { // prevents from infinite recursion if (mProtectFromCheckedChange) { return; } mProtectFromCheckedChange = true; if (mCheckedId != -1) { setCheckedStateForView(mCheckedId, false); } mProtectFromCheckedChange = false; int id = buttonView.getId(); setCheckedId(id); } } /** * <p>A pass-through listener acts upon the events and dispatches them * to another listener. This allows the table layout to set its own internal * hierarchy change listener without preventing the user to setup his.</p> */ private class PassThroughHierarchyChangeListener implements ViewGroup.OnHierarchyChangeListener { private ViewGroup.OnHierarchyChangeListener mOnHierarchyChangeListener; /** * {@inheritDoc} */ @SuppressLint("NewApi")public void onChildViewAdded(View parent, View child) { if (parent == MutilRadioGroup.this ) { List<RadioButton> btns = getAllRadioButton(child); if(btns != null && btns.size() > 0){ for(RadioButton btn : btns){ int id = btn.getId(); // generates an id if it's missing if (id == View.NO_ID && Build.VERSION.SDK_INT >= Build.VERSION_CODES.JELLY_BEAN_MR1) { id = View.generateViewId(); btn.setId(id); } btn.setOnCheckedChangeListener( mChildOnCheckedChangeListener); } } } if (mOnHierarchyChangeListener != null) { mOnHierarchyChangeListener.onChildViewAdded(parent, child); } } /** * {@inheritDoc} */ public void onChildViewRemoved(View parent, View child) { if (parent == MutilRadioGroup.this) { List<RadioButton> btns = getAllRadioButton(child); if(btns != null && btns.size() > 0){ for(RadioButton btn : btns){ btn.setOnCheckedChangeListener(null); } } } if (mOnHierarchyChangeListener != null) { mOnHierarchyChangeListener.onChildViewRemoved(parent, child); } } }}
